Linking Theory and Practice

STEM activities make the connection between theoretical understanding and real-world application possible. These exercises give abstract concepts life by providing students with practical experiences. These kinds of activities help make learning concrete and approachable, whether building models to comprehend engineering concepts or doing experiments to investigate scientific hypotheses.

Developing Crucial Competencies

Participating in STEM pursuits fosters analytical reasoning and problem-solving abilities. Students face problems that call for creative fixes. Whether diagnosing a problem in a robotics project or creating plans to maximize resources in a scientific experiment, these kinds of tasks foster creativity and analytical thinking.

Encouraging Cooperation and Unity

Success in the professional sphere is largely dependent on teamwork. STEM activities frequently involve group projects, simulating real-world situations where people with different skill sets come together to accomplish shared objectives. Pupils discover the value of delegating tasks to one another, communicating effectively, and utilizing individual abilities to achieve group goals.
